How to Boost Immune System Naturally.. Flu and gastroenteritis reach epidemic levels in winters in Europe especially around the time between Christmas and New Years Day, according to an epidemiological bulletin. 

Against the highly contagious viral diseases, an immune system that is in good shape will be your best ally to prevent them from happening or to help fight against them. So how to boost immune system naturally?  Here are some tips to practice daily:

A balanced diet

Having a balanced, healthy and a varied diet is essential to maintain a strong immune system. To get plenty of vitamins and minerals- antioxidants, consumption of fruits and vegetables is essential. Key here is to take in sufficient amounts of vitamin C, B2, B5, but also trace minerals such as iron, selenium and zinc.

In winter months, you should eat oranges, mandarines, kiwis, cabbage and carrots. Although the desire to have vegetables is lower in winter than in summer, vegetable consumption is more necessary than ever. Dietary supplements, including multi vitamin cocktails containing minerals also help the immune system for winter.

Other foods, pulses (iron and selenium), such as seafood (zinc and iron), garlic and onion (vitamin C and selenium) strengthen the immune system. Finally, you need to consume enough protein, that will help the formation of antibodies against infections. They are mainly found in fish, red meat, poultry and eggs.

Drink enough

Drinking limits the progression of infections. In winter, the consumption of tea and herbal teas help you stay well hydrated. However, do drink have them too sweet, as this will only slow down your immune system.

Be careful about hygiene

To avoid catching a virus, you should regularly wash your hands before eating or after taking the public transport. To protect others, it is advisable to sneeze into a tissue and to throw it in the bin.

Exercise regularly

Regular physical exercise boosts the immune system, and also has the advantage of reducing stress. But warming up before the exercise is important, especially in cold temperatures.

Staying calm and stress free

Stress is one of the greatest enemies of the immune system. It is detrimental to the formation of white blood cells or leukocytes, which help fight against infections. A stressed person is more vulnerable to viruses and bacteria than someone more relaxed. It is therefore necessary to relax as much as possible, and try and be positive in all circumstances.

Attention to alcohol and tobacco

Tobacco multiplies the amount of free radicals in the body, which reduces the levels of vitamin C, hence the body’s immunity. As for alcohol, it diminishes the power of white blood cells, and tends to dehydrate your body. Moderation is the key here with alcohol.
